What companies run services between Castlebar, Ireland and Saltmills, IE-WX, Ireland?

You can take a train from Castlebar to Saltmills via Portarlington, Kildare, and Waterford in around 6h 19m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Castlebar to Saltmills via Airport Zone 11, Airport Zone 14, Enniscorthy, and New Ross in around 10h 14m.
